Abstract
The utility model discloses an anti-skid and wear-resistant sole, which structurally comprises a sole, wherein the sole comprises a front anti-skid area and a rear anti-skid area, the front anti-skid area is provided with a strip-shaped groove, anti-skid blocks and wear-resistant blocks, the strip-shaped groove is arranged at the front end of the front anti-skid area, the anti-skid blocks are arranged below the strip-shaped groove, the wear-resistant blocks are respectively distributed at two sides of the anti-skid blocks, excellent anti-skid performance can be effectively provided for the sole through the arrangement of the strip-shaped groove and the anti-skid blocks, the wear-resistant blocks at two sides are made of wear-resistant materials, better wear-resistant performance is achieved, dredging grooves and bumps are arranged for dewatering and further increasing the anti-skid and wear-resistant performance of the sole, and finally a damping area is arranged, so that the sole has better elastic damping function and increases the experience during use.

Background
The construction of the sole is quite complex and, in a broad sense, may include all of the materials comprising the sole, midsole, heel, etc. In a narrow sense, the sole material should have the common characteristics of wear resistance, water resistance, oil resistance, heat resistance, pressure resistance, impact resistance, good elasticity, easy adaptation to the foot, difficult deformation after shaping, heat preservation, easy absorption of moisture and the like, and the sole material should be matched with the midsole, so that the sole material has various conditions of no slipping, easy stopping and the like due to the braking effect when walking for changing feet, and the sole material has various types and can be divided into a natural base material and a synthetic base material. The natural base material comprises natural base leather, bamboo, wood and the like, the synthetic base material comprises rubber, plastic, rubber and plastic materials, regenerated leather, elastic hard paper board and the like, one main factor of the sole is skid resistance and wear resistance, the existing sole is poor in wear resistance, the bottom is easy to wear flat, the skid resistance of the sole is greatly reduced, the elasticity of the sole is also an important experience when people wear the sole, people can feel a large hard feel when wearing the sole with poor elasticity, and therefore the skid resistance and wear resistance sole is provided.
Disclosure of Invention
Aiming at the defects existing in the prior art, the utility model aims to provide an anti-skid and wear-resistant sole for solving the existing problems.
In order to achieve the above object, the present utility model is realized by the following technical scheme: the utility model provides an anti-skidding wear-resisting sole, its structure includes the sole includes preceding anti-skidding district, back anti-skidding district, preceding anti-skidding district is equipped with strip recess, anti-skidding block, wear-resisting piece on the preceding anti-skidding district, strip recess is located preceding anti-skidding district's front end, the anti-skidding block be equipped with several and each the anti-skidding block arrange set up in strip recess below, the wear-resisting piece be equipped with several and each the wear-resisting piece distribute respectively in the both sides of anti-skidding block.
Further, the strip-shaped grooves, the anti-skid blocks and the wear-resistant blocks are also arranged on the rear anti-skid area, and the layout of the rear anti-skid area is consistent with that of the front anti-skid area.
Further, a shock absorbing area is arranged on the sole, and the shock absorbing area is located right above the rear anti-skid area.
Further, the shock absorption area comprises an elastic round pad, a spring and an elastic square pad, wherein the elastic round pad is located in the middle of the shock absorption area, the spring is sleeved on the elastic round pad, and the elastic square pad is arranged on two sides of the elastic round pad.
Further, each wear-resisting block is provided with a dredging groove, each dredging groove is provided with a convex block, and the height of the convex block is slightly higher than that of the wear-resisting block.
The beneficial effects of the utility model are as follows: through the setting of strip recess and antiskid piece, can effectually provide outstanding skid resistance for the sole, the wear-resisting piece of both sides is wear-resisting material, possess better wear resistance and be equipped with the mediation groove and the lug and be used for hydrophobic and further its skid resistance and wear resistance that increases, be equipped with the shock attenuation district at last, have better elasticity shock-absorbing function, experience when increasing the use.
